The rims of reused jars are commonly just a bit thinner than the rims of certified mason jars, making it harder for the rubber gaskets on the undersides of the lids to get something to grip onto and make a strong, lasting seal. Keep your jars clean and store them in a safe place where they will not be damaged in between canning sessions. Most experts advise avoiding such jars in pressure canning, if possible.
